RETURNED 2010 AFTER 20 YEARS BELOW THE FEDERAL LINE
The great Victorian mouthful. First reported in 1880, Euphemia fell below the line and stayed there from 1990 through 2009 — 20 years. It returned in 2010; in 2025 the register shows 19 births, against a peak of 26 in 1915.
| First reported | 1880 |
|---|---|
| Last reported | 2025 — 19 births |
| Peak | 1915 — 26 births |
| Total recorded, 1880–2025 | 771 |
| Years above the line | 78 of a possible 146 |
| Longest absence | 20 years (1990–2009) |
| Returned | 2010 |
Source: U.S. Social Security Administration national names file (1880–2025). Names below 5 occurrences in a year are not reported.
